#a07487 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a07487 is composed of 62.7% red, 45.5%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 334.1 degrees, a saturation of 18.8% and a lightness of 54.1%. #a07487 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#41000f.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#a07487 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.

#a07487 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a07487 has RGB values of R:160, G:116,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.16,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10515591.

Shades and Tints of #a07487

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a07487

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8689 is the less saturated color, while #fa1a7b is the most saturated one.
